How to Connect Capacities to Cline via MCP

Follow these steps to integrate the Capacities MCP Server with Cline.

01

Open Cline MCP Settings

Click the MCP Servers icon in the Cline sidebar panel

02

Add remote server

Click "Add MCP Server" and paste the configuration above

03

Enable the server

Toggle the server switch to ON

04

Start using Capacities

Ask Cline: "Using Capacities, help me...". 10 tools available

Capacities MCP Tools for Cline (10)

These 10 tools become available when you connect Capacities to Cline via MCP:

01

add_tag

Add a structural categorical Tag linking explicitly dynamically grouping related Graph items via relations

02

create_object

Create a new typed object in a Capacities space bounded by specific graph rules instantiating entities

03

get_object

Retrieve a specific full explicit object by ID accessing its root graph data traversing properties internally

04

get_space_info

Retrieve detailed information about a Capacities space including all object types (structures), their property definitions, and configuration

05

get_structures

Get all object type definitions (structures) within a Capacities space exposing exact metadata parameters limitlessly

06

list_spaces

List all personal spaces in the Capacities account. Spaces are top-level containers for organizing objects, notes, and knowledge

07

lookup

Search for content across a specific Capacities space by title or explicit keywords tracking exact nodes

08

save_media

Locate and attach an explicit Media payload explicitly binding it directly onto existing specific record scopes

09

save_to_daily_note

Append strict Markdown textual payloads to the dynamically mapped daily note explicitly linking content blocks

10

save_weblink

Save a web URL as a Weblink object dynamically tracking automatic preview generation natively

Capacities + Cline FAQ

Common questions about integrating Capacities MCP Server with Cline.

01

How does Cline connect to MCP servers?

Cline reads MCP server configurations from its settings panel in VS Code. Add the server URL and Cline discovers all available tools on initialization.
02

Can Cline run MCP tools without approval?

By default, Cline asks for confirmation before executing tool calls. You can configure auto-approval rules for trusted servers in the settings.
03

Does Cline support multiple MCP servers at once?

Yes. Configure as many servers as needed. Cline can use tools from different servers within the same autonomous task execution.
